Dracula: The Disciple, a new first-person puzzle game, is set for release in 2027

Nacon and Cyanide Studio (Styx) have unveiled Dracula: The Disciple, which will be released in 2027 on PS5, Xbox Series X|S, and PC.

It is a first-person puzzle game in which players must uncover the secrets hidden within Count Dracula’s castle. Numerous esoteric puzzles will pace the progression of the gameplay. The famous vampire’s residence holds many mysteries that must be unraveled.
